Malicious actors frequently upload fake cheating tools to GitHub. These repositories may contain hidden malware, such as trojans or info-stealers. Once executed, these programs can steal stored passwords, personal data, and financial information from the user's computer. Browser Extension Bans If you or someone you know is struggling

These scripts work by manipulating the , which is essentially the browser's representation of a webpage. For example, a script can wait for a specific button to load and then automatically click it. One such script claims to "Automatically unlocks all sections in an Edmentum tutorial". Another, the "Fixed Edmentum Skip Tutorials" script, adds more advanced logic, using a MutationObserver to detect when new page elements are added and clicking them automatically.
